I have windows 2003 enterprise setup on my workstation and I would like to run a webserver. After installing IIS6 from Add Remove Windows Components, IIS refuses to function. I had it working on this system prior to a reformat, so I know it does work on this machine. After installing IIS the World Wide Web Publishing service does not show up in services.msc, as it did before. When I try to start IIS Admin serviec I get the following error:

Error 2: The system cannot find the file specified.

My services are heavily tweaked and I think the problem might stem from it, here is the configuration:

Auto:
-Cryptographic Services
-DHCP
-Event Log
-HHTP SSL
-IIS Admin
-Network Connections
-PnP
-Remote Procedure Call
-Security Accounts Manager
-Windows Audio
-Windows Managment Instrumentation
-Workstation

Manual:
-Applicaion Managment
-Machine Debug Manager
-RPC Locator
-Windows Installer
-Windows Managment Instrumentation Driver Ex

Disabled:
-everything else

Do you guys have any suggestions?
